Advanced / USB Configuration Sub-menu
This menu allows USB controller configuration
Figure 39: Advanced / USB Configuration sub menu
A detailed description of each of the features is given in the following table.
Table 40: Advanced / USB Configuration sub menu
Feature Options Description
USB Function
Disabled
All USB Ports
[Default]
2 USB Ports
Allows enable or disable the USB function.
Legacy USB
Support
Disabled
Enabled
Auto [Default]
Allows the system to detect the presence of USB
devices at
start up. If detected, the USB controller
legacy mode is enabled. If no USB device is detected,
the legacy USB support is disabled.
USB 2.0 controller
Enabled [Default]
Auto Disabled
Allows you to enable or disable the USB 2.0
controller.
USB Controller
Mode
Hi Speed
[Default]
Full Speed
Allows the USB 2.0 controller mode to HiSpeed (480
Mbps) or
FullSpeed (12 Mbps).
